10 Reasons Why Your Company Needs An Effective Web Site!

1. Be Open For Business 24 Hours A Day

Your business is open to the world 24 hours a day, 7 days a week with no labor costs to watch out for and a website faces no time zone barriers.

2. Reach New Markets With a Global Audience

The Internet is the most cost effective way to trade nationally and internationally. A website will broaden your base of customers, members, distributors or suppliers. You can generate more and more clients for your business without doing additional marketing or having to endure additional marketing costs. Today, more and more customers are making purchases through the Internet. Why should you limit your business to your immediate locale when the whole world may be your potential market? Thanks to the Internet, it is as easy to sell halfway across the world as it is to sell across the street.

3. Marketing Hot Spot For The Global Economy

The Internet has become the marketing hot spot for the global economy. Many business leaders are realizing that their organizations will thrive in this global internet economy who will grasp its importance before their competitors do. A well-designed website is not only an internet identity for your organization, it is an essential part of the success and future of your company this new information age.

4. Present a Professional and Credible Image

Your organization must make the leap into the new marketing realm if it is to be perceived as professional in today's marketplace. Today, customers, employees, and suppliers expect to be able to find and communicate with a business online. It is very much like having to be listed in the yellow pages in the past, if you do not have a listing, potential customers will not be able to find you and have confidence in your business over your competition. Businesses that do not have a Web presence are making a statement about their inability to embrace technology and adapt to change in today's growing technical environment. For a small business, a well-designed website is a great way of creating credibility and looking bigger than you actually are. You can look like one of the big corporations at a very small cost. When one compares the cost of establishing a website to what it costs to promote a business in any other traditional media (newspaper, radio, television), it is evident that a website is the cheapest form of marketing ever created for the audience and value it brings to your business.

5. Improved Customer Service

You can provide 24 hour customer service without hiring any additional employees. Your customers are better served when they can access information about your products or services immediately via your website rather than waiting for a mailed brochure or a return telephone call. In today's fast-paced market, how quickly and conveniently customers can access the information or purchase the product is frequently the factor that determines who will win the sale. Providing answers to frequently asked questions on your website. fulfilling information requests that are processed immediately via online forms and autoresponders are all valuable tools to satisfy new customers whether someone is in the office or not.

6. Save Money on Printing and Distribution Costs

A website is your online brochure or catalog that can be changed or updated at anytime at a much cheaper and faster rate than print material. It saves you money on printing and distribution costs.

7. Automation, Productivity, and Profitability

Through Internet automation you can increase productivity and profitability. Automating your sale process can reduce costs for advertising, sales personnel, and other support staff. A website increases your company's productivity because less time is spent explaining product or service details to customers since such information would be available 24 hours a day on your website at your customers chosen time not yours. A website saves costs by allowing users the flexibility to download invoices, business proposals and other important documents. Your website can also allow the customers, employees, and suppliers to have their email address added to your mailing list. Sending an email to your entire email list can be done at virtually no cost.

8. Sell Your Products and Services Online

Selling through your website is much cheaper and a great way to supplement your offline business. Providing secure online ordering is very affordable today. That explains why the online commerce has surpassed $188 billion in 2004.

9. Stability

You may move your place of business, change your phone number, alter business hours but your website address never changes and your website is always open.

10. Great Recruiting Tool

You can post job opportunities with your company on your website plus provide company information for all of your employees.
